How to get there

How to Reach Tzimol in Mexico

Tzimol is a charming village located in the Chiapas state of Mexico. Surrounded by lush greenery and stunning natural landscapes, it offers a peaceful retreat for nature lovers and adventure seekers alike. If you're planning a visit to Tzimol, here are a few ways to reach this hidden gem:

By Air

The closest major airport to Tzimol is the Ángel Albino Corzo International Airport, located in Tuxtla Gutiérrez. From the airport, you can hire a taxi or rent a car to reach Tzimol. The journey takes approximately 2.5 hours, and the route offers breathtaking views of the Chiapas countryside.

By Road

If you prefer a scenic road trip, driving to Tzimol is a great option. From Tuxtla Gutiérrez, take Highway 190 towards Comitán de Domínguez. Once you reach Comitán, continue on Highway 307 towards Chancalá. From Chancalá, follow the signs to Tzimol. The drive takes around 3 hours, and the roads are well-maintained.

By Public Transportation

For budget-conscious travelers, public transportation is a convenient option. From Tuxtla Gutiérrez, you can take a bus to Comitán de Domínguez. From Comitán, there are frequent local buses that will take you to Tzimol. The journey by public transportation may take longer, but it allows you to immerse yourself in the local culture and enjoy the scenic views along the way.

Getting to know Tzimol

Tzimol is a small village located in the state of Chiapas, Mexico. Nestled in the lush green mountains of the region, this charming town offers a unique and off-the-beaten-path experience for travelers seeking a peaceful retreat.

Known for its stunning natural beauty, Tzimol is surrounded by dense forests, cascading waterfalls, and pristine rivers. The village is also home to the breathtaking El Chiflón waterfall, one of the tallest in Mexico, where visitors can take a refreshing dip in its crystal-clear turquoise waters, or embark on a thrilling zipline adventure.

The local culture and traditions of Tzimol are of great importance to its residents, and visitors have the opportunity to immerse themselves in the vibrant indigenous culture of the area. The village is primarily inhabited by the Tzotzil Mayan community, whose rich history can be explored through their colorful traditional clothing, intricate handicrafts, and ancient rituals.

Travelers can also explore the nearby Montebello Lakes National Park, a UNESCO World Heritage Site renowned for its stunning collection of more than 50 turquoise lakes. The park offers various hiking trails, camping sites, and picnic spots, providing nature enthusiasts with a myriad of opportunities to connect with the surrounding flora and fauna.
